Tunnel vision: Tunnel vision is a relatively specific symptom and usuall is a result of retinal disease. It is not contagious such that other people pick it up from someone else. But it can be hereditary as in retinitis pigmentosa or other retinal disorders, glaucoma or neurological disorders including tumors or physcological problems. This is a serious complaint and needs prompt evaluation and therapy.
